Summary
This PR updates a couple ML data-test-subj attributes.
Details
data-test-subjattributes to table action menu entries, so we no longer have to rely on the button text.data-test-subjattributes in ML are now all prefixed with themlnamespace (and some of them have a bit more context in their name now).
